Fellow soccer community members and friends, cancer has invaded our fraternity. We have all been saddened by stories of cancer victims but now there is a face to this story. A member of the Texas Premier Soccer Club, Nick Doize is 14 years old and has been stricken with a Acute Lymphoblastic Leukemia that has relapsed into his Central Nervous System. He has been bravely fighting this vicious disease for well over a year now. Nick has battled through multiple chemotherapy treatments, and due to a recent relapse, will undergo a Bone Marrow Transplant.

Nick is a wonderful kid and seeing him toil with this disease has personalized what cancer does to people, especially our young ones. It has made many of ask ourselves “what can we do?” Well, there is something that we can ALL do.
